Interview Process at Dentsu
At Dentsu, our interview process typically involves three rounds.
Initial Screening:
We begin by reviewing the candidate’s CV — often created using AI tools — to understand their background and experience.
Portfolio Presentation & Case Study Review:
In this round, candidates are asked to present their portfolio, walk through case studies, and demonstrate their problem-solving approach. We assess their understanding of design systems, awareness of current design trends, clarity in articulating their process, and passion for design. This stage also includes a Q&A session about their design journey and key projects.
Task & Final Discussion:
The final round usually involves a small design task followed by a discussion on the approach and rationale.
We generally prefer candidates with a formal design education — a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Design, especially from institutes like NID, IIT, MIT-ID, or Srishti — as this provides the academic grounding and technical rigor we look for. Candidates without a design background are usually not considered, as our work demands a deep understanding of design fundamentals and methodology.
